COLFAX, Wash. – The Idaho cross country men finished second and the women third at the Cougar Classic hosted by Washington State at the Colfax Golf Club.
On the men's side, Gonzaga finished with the top seven spots to earn the win, but the Vandals finished in front of Washington State and Eastern Washington.
Tim Stevens and Shea Mattson led the Vandal men. Stevens crossed the line on the 8K course with a time of 24:49.5 edging out Mattson by 7/10s of a second for the No. 11 spot. Michael McCausland was 13th with a time of 24.57.
Ben Shaw finished 16th with a time of 25:11.7 and Lorenz Herrmann finished 17th with a time of 25:18.4 to round out the scoring for Idaho.
On the women's side, Gonzaga grabbed the top spot and Washington State finished in second ahead of the Vandals.
Nell Baker led Idaho on the women's side. She finished the 6K course with a time of 21:15.5. Maya Kobylanski was 11th with a time of 21:32.5. Kelsey Swenson was 13th with a time of 21:40.1. Leah Holmgren was 17th with a time of 21:57.2. Jolene Whitely finished 18th with a time of 22:10.4.
